Why I Consider the Nikon D5300

I like the Nikon D5300 because it gives me excellent photo quality, a lightweight body, and useful features that make learning photography easier. The 24.2MP sensor delivers sharp images, and the lack of an optical low-pass filter helps preserve detail. For me, that means I can get crisp results even without advanced editing.

Image Quality

One of the biggest reasons I would choose the D5300 is image quality. I find its APS-C sensor performs very well in daylight and still holds up nicely in low light. The photos look clean, detailed, and natural. If image quality is your top priority, this camera is a strong option in its class.

Ease of Use

From my experience, the D5300 is beginner-friendly. The menu system is straightforward, and the camera offers helpful automatic modes for new users. At the same time, it also gives me manual controls when I want to learn more and improve my photography skills.

Built-in Wi-Fi and GPS

I appreciate that the D5300 includes built-in Wi-Fi and GPS. Wi-Fi makes it easy for me to transfer photos to my phone or share them quickly. GPS is useful when I want to keep track of where I took my pictures, especially during travel.

Display and Viewfinder

The 3.2-inch vari-angle LCD is one of my favorite features. I find it very useful for shooting from high or low angles, and it also helps when taking selfies or video. The optical viewfinder gives me a clear view for traditional shooting, which I still prefer in many situations.

Video Performance

If I want to record video, the Nikon D5300 does a good job with Full HD 1080p recording. It is not a professional cinema camera, but for personal videos, family moments, or content creation, I think it performs well. The flip-out screen also makes video shooting much easier for me.

Lens Compatibility

Before buying, I would also think about lens options. The D5300 works with Nikon F-mount lenses, which gives me access to a wide range of choices. This is important because the camera body is only part of the system. A good lens can make a big difference in the final result.

Battery Life

I find the battery life on the D5300 decent for a DSLR in this category. It is good enough for casual photography, day trips, and regular use. Still, if I plan to shoot for long periods, I would consider carrying a spare battery.
